Facebook has also set up mock hearings involving its communications team and outside advisers who role-play members of Congress.Internal staff has pushed Zuckerberg to answer lawmakers’ questions directly, and not to appear overly defensive. Their goal is to make Zuckerberg appear as humble, agreeable and as forthright as possible, the people close to the preparations said. Brown, a former special assistant to President George W. Bush, is leading the WilmerHale group. In these hearings, Democrats are expected to grill Zuckerberg about the privacy scandals, and how the social network is guarding against possible interference in this fall’s midterm elections.
